"Ma, I'm home!" Maya yells into the apartment when she returns home from school on Tuesday afternoon. 

"I'm in here!" She called out and Maya manoeuvres herself around the boxes containing their stuff to follow her voice to the kitchen. Katy and Shawn, now being engaged, decided that they'd move into Shawn's place which was in a better part of the city and fairly bigger.

"Hey, I'm- Oh hi Mrs. Adams." Maya greets the lady who sat on the kitchen floor with her mother wrapping plates in news paper before putting them in boxes.

"Hello there." She replies smiling. "How was school?"

"Fine." She replies, taking slow steps out of the kitchen. 

"What was it you wanted, baby girl?" Her mother asks looking up at her.

"Nothing, never mind." she says walking towards the door. "I'm going to go to the park for a while." she says finally in the doorway.

"Okay, but call me if you need anything." She says and Maya turns to leave.

 Maya moves down the hall quickly, in a hurry to put my bag in my room and grab some stuff but as she was about to enter her room the bathroom door opened up and Ashton stepped out.

"Aye, Maya!" Ashton smiles at her closing the bathroom door behind her.

"Hi." She flash her a tight lipped smile pushing her bedroom door open and stepping in.

"You staying to help pack?" she questions following Maya into her room. "You're hardly ever here!"

Maya's mom works for Ashton's step-father, William Adams as his personal secretary and after she had dinner with Mrs. Adams that one time they became close friends. 

Ashton's step father was a partner at Adams & Tate, it was one of the most successful law firms in the entirety of New York. Katy and Mrs. Adams talked to each other a lot when she visited her husband at work and somehow dinner at the Hart's came up. Now when her mother wasn't working or with Shawn she was spending her time with Mrs. Adams and usually where Mrs. Adams was, Ashton was nearby.

"I'm a busy gal." She says gathering some art supplies and putting them into a messenger bag, throwing it over her shoulder.

"Where you goin'?" she asks following Maya down the hall.

"To the park." she says pulling back on her shoes at the door. 

"I could come?"

Maya internally rolled her eyes at her. She wanted to scream out 'NO' but she was supposed to play nice with her. "Sure, why not?" she smiles falsely.

"Cool!" She says moving back to the living room and picking up her bag from the couch. "Mommy!" she calls out to her mother who was laughing with Maya's on the kitchen floor, wine glass in hand. "I goin' to the park with Maya!"

"A'right, but come back by six." Mrs. Adams tells her daughter and Ashton doesn't bother replying just moves to join Maya by the door pushing her feet into her shoes.
